Well, the Hijri date 29 Ramadan 1428 corresponds to the Gregorian date Thursday, 11 October 2007. This date lies in the ninth month of the Hijri year 1428 AH, which is Ramadan of 1428 AH. Both this Hijri and Gregorian date occur on the single day that is Thursday without any doubt. The Arabic date 1428/09/29 is calculated using the Umm Al-Qura calendar and the sighting of the moon. One thing to remember is that this Arabic date may occur on different Gregorian date depending upon the region and country and obviously the moon.

Sahih al-Bukhari
Manumission of Slaves
Chapter: It is dislike to look down upon a slave
Narrated Ibn `Umar:
The Prophet (ﷺ) said, "If one manumits his share of a common slave (Abd), and he has money sufficient to free the remaining portion of the price of the slave (justly estimated), then he should free the slave completely by paying the rest of his price; otherwise the slave is freed partly. "
Sahih al-Bukhari 2553
